About Noosaville 4566

The size of Noosaville is approximately 25.8 square kilometres. There are 29 parks, covering nearly 25.0% of the total area. The population of Noosaville in 2016 was 8124 people. By 2021 the population was 8716 showing a population growth of 7.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Noosaville is 70-79 years. Households in Noosaville are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Noosaville work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 69.80% of the homes in Noosaville were owner-occupied compared with 65.80% in 2016.

Noosaville has 7,596 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Noosaville have seen a 24.05%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 47.12% increase. As at 31 July 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Noosaville is $2,027,502 while the median value for Units is $1,095,770.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,250 while Units have a median rent of $780.
